Renowned Comedian Javed Kodu Passed Away

Veteran Pakistani stage and television actor Javed Kodu, celebrated for his comedic flair and unique short stature, passed away early Sunday following a prolonged illness.

The funeral prayers for renowned stage and television actor Javed Kodu will be held today at the marquee behind his residence in Singhpura, with burial to follow at the Singhpura graveyard.

Kodu, who devoted over 40 years to the entertainment industry, leaves behind a lasting legacy of humor, resilience, and heartfelt performances, according to media reports.

Born with dwarfism, Kodu overcame significant societal and professional challenges. Despite enduring ridicule and discrimination both on and off stage, he persevered to become one of Pakistan’s most cherished theatre icons.

His nickname, “Kodu,” was affectionately given to him by legendary comedian Akhtar Hussain Albela.

Kodu began his acting career in 1981 with the play *Sode Baaz* and went on to appear in more than 150 Punjabi and Urdu films, along with numerous stage performances. His standout television role in the popular drama *Ashiyana* remains fondly remembered by fans.

He is survived by his son Salman Kodu and another son, Shera, a well-known performer on *Mazaaq Raat*, who has followed in his father’s footsteps.

**Prime Minister expresses sorrow over Kodu’s passing**

Prime Minister Shehbaz Sharif expressed deep sorrow over Kodu’s death. In a statement from the PM Office Media Wing, the premier prayed for Kodu’s elevated rank in paradise and offered condolences to the grieving family, wishing them strength to bear the loss.

The prime minister acknowledged that Kodu rose to fame through his exceptional acting skills and said his passing had created a void in the media industry that could never be filled. He extended heartfelt sympathies to the bereaved family during this difficult time.
